Analysis

In 2019, prevalence of hypertension in Sri Lanka stood at 35.6%. That is the highest value across all 30 years on record.

That represents a change of up 0.8% on the previous year and up 7.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, prevalence of hypertension in Sri Lanka peaked at 35.6% in 2019 and was at its lowest, 31.7%, in 1994.

Sri Lanka ranks 118th of 192 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 30 years of available data.

Sri Lanka compared with similar countries

  • Sri Lanka's 35.6% is below the median for upper middle income countries, which is 40.5%, 88% of the median. (58 countries reporting)
  • Sri Lanka's 35.6% is above the median for South Asia, which is 34.9%, 1.0× the median. (6 countries reporting)

Prevalence of hypertension is the percentage of adults ages 30-79 with hypertension (defined as having systolic blood pressure =140 mmHg, diastolic blood pressure =90 mmHg, or taking medication for hypertension). The data is age-standardized.
